You can Probably find a Package deal..That has subs,box,amp all together...This will sound ok...and you might be able to come close to that budget...But lets say Interior speakers are at least going to be Around $120  for 2 pair of decent speakers...But i would recommend installing a aftermarket cd player as well...Lets say another $120...That only leaves $160 for everything else...Amp,Subs,Box,Amp Kit,Stereo Mounting Kit,Stereo Harness...?

Your budget is waaaaay too low for your expectations, especially here in Canada. Where in BC are you? Do this upgrade a step at a time, a cd player and one pair of speakers to start. Then add the second set of speakers. Then add a amp to power the front speakers and a future sub. Then add the sub / box.

Buying a used sub is never a good deal. It is the most abused part of a stereo. Your budget is going to severly limit the system on you. You are best off adding the sub and amp at a later date or buy the sub and wait to buy an amp. You are literally more than likely going to get absolute crap for the investment you have if you try and do it all with $600,00 and that is a huge waste of money.
